The Religious Studies Program

At Le Moyne College, we believe that exploring life's religious dimensions yields valuable insights into individuals as well as entire cultures.  Beyond its often-profound personal impact, religious plays a central role in shaping societies, prompting political action and influencing the course of history.  Examining the nature and function of religion is therefore an essential part of a liberal arts education.  For students who seek to understand the immense influence of organized religions and spiritual beliefs, a religious studies major or minor is an ideal course of study.
